- ************* Results of the Mixed Loading Rule Check ******************* ?The SAP error message DG682 typically relates to issues with mixed loading rules in the context of Dangerous Goods Management (DGM) within SAP. This error occurs when the system detects that the loading of dangerous goods does not comply with the established mixed loading rules, which are designed to ensure safety during the transportation of hazardous materials.
Cause:
The error can be triggered by several factors, including:
- Incompatible Dangerous Goods: The items being loaded together may have incompatible properties (e.g., flammable materials mixed with oxidizers).
- Missing or Incorrect Data: The dangerous goods master data may be incomplete or incorrectly configured, leading to improper assessments of compatibility.
- Regulatory Compliance: The loading configuration may not comply with local or international regulations regarding the transport of dangerous goods.
- Loading Group Conflicts: The loading groups assigned to the materials may not allow for mixed loading.
Solution:
To resolve the DG682 error, consider the following steps:
Review Dangerous Goods Master Data: Check the master data for the materials involved to ensure that all necessary information is correctly entered, including UN numbers, packing groups, and compatibility information.
Check Mixed Loading Rules: Review the mixed loading rules configured in the system. Ensure that the rules allow for the combination of the specific dangerous goods being loaded together.
Adjust Loading Groups: If applicable, modify the loading groups assigned to the materials to ensure they are compatible for mixed loading.
Consult Regulatory Guidelines: Ensure that the loading configuration adheres to relevant regulations (e.g., ADR, IMDG) for the transport of dangerous goods.
Test Different Combinations: If possible, test different combinations of materials to identify which specific items are causing the conflict.
Consult SAP Documentation: Refer to SAP Help documentation or consult with your SAP support team for specific guidance related to your version of SAP and the configuration of dangerous goods management.
